Mustafa Aslan, known as 'Kahtalı Mıçe', diagnosed with cancer
It has been revealed that singer Mustafa Aslan, known as 'Kahtalı Mıçe', has been diagnosed with cancer. The famous artist, who has been diagnosed with laryngeal cancer, is receiving treatment in Antalya.
Sad news has arrived regarding Mustafa Aslan, who rose to fame with the nickname 'Kahtalı Mıçe'.
It has been revealed that the 71-year-old Turkish folk music artist, who is reported to be going through difficult days regarding his health, is receiving treatment at the Akdeniz University Faculty of Medicine.
'RECEIVING TREATMENT IN ANTALYA'
Onur Akay provided information about Kahtalı Mıçe's health status: "Our artist, who has been diagnosed with laryngeal cancer, is receiving treatment in Antalya. Our artist, who is hospitalized at the Akdeniz University Faculty of Medicine, is also continuing his chemotherapy treatment. I also learned that our artist is experiencing financial difficulties..."
